From 4aa35562c0d91c41a83cf150e9c1939a44f4fbf7 Mon Sep 17 00:00:00 2001 From: Wender Teixeira Date: Mon, 13 Dec 2021 18:04:27 -0300 Subject: [PATCH] Fix bug farewellMessage --- backend/src/controllers/WhatsAppController.ts | 3 +++ backend/src/services/WbotServices/wbotMessageListener.ts | 2 +- 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/backend/src/controllers/WhatsAppController.ts b/backend/src/controllers/WhatsAppController.ts index da974ac..3b4d9fb 100644 --- a/backend/src/controllers/WhatsAppController.ts +++ b/backend/src/controllers/WhatsAppController.ts @@ -13,6 +13,7 @@ interface WhatsappData { name: string; queueIds: number[]; greetingMessage?: string; + farewellMessage?: string; status?: string; isDefault?: boolean; } @@ -29,6 +30,7 @@ export const store = async (req: Request, res: Response): Promise => { status, isDefault, greetingMessage, + farewellMessage, queueIds }: WhatsappData = req.body; @@ -37,6 +39,7 @@ export const store = async (req: Request, res: Response): Promise => { status, isDefault, greetingMessage, + farewellMessage, queueIds }); diff --git a/backend/src/services/WbotServices/wbotMessageListener.ts b/backend/src/services/WbotServices/wbotMessageListener.ts index cb73d52..c443ebc 100644 --- a/backend/src/services/WbotServices/wbotMessageListener.ts +++ b/backend/src/services/WbotServices/wbotMessageListener.ts @@ -249,7 +249,7 @@ const handleMessage = async ( const contact = await verifyContact(msgContact); - if(unreadMessages === 0 && whatsapp.farewellMessage === msg.body) return; + if ( unreadMessages === 0 && whatsapp.farewellMessage && whatsapp.farewellMessage === msg.body) return; const ticket = await FindOrCreateTicketService( contact,